The Great Glen traverses the north of Scotland between Fort William and Inverness . Here, amidst a spectacular backdrop, the Caledonian Canal links the waters of Loch Ness, Loch Oich and Loch Lochy, forming an unparalleled coast to coast waterway. The canal and the Great Glen are enjoyed by many people each year however there is currently no provision for disabled people to experience a residential activity holiday afloat.

Our Vision is to build a boat which will be accessible to people of all abilities, which will:
- Offer residential holidays/cruises, living onboard and cruising the Caledonian Canal.
- Offer a variety of outdoor/adventure activities specifically designed for people with a range of different abilities.
- Enable families with one or more disabled members to enjoy holidays together.
- Act as a floating education, interpretation and resource centre for both visitors and locals wishing to learn about the history, geology, mythology and culture of The Great Glen and the construction and history of the Caledonian Canal.
- Be part crewed and maintained by volunteer members of the local community.
- Offer bursaries so that the project is affordable to all.
